What is my job called in English?

Hi all,

I am a passive sales broker (that is what we call it here) in a non-English speaking country and I would like to know what my job is actually called in English finance industry.

I deal with portfolio managers in asset management firms or banks (dealing passive funds, not active funds). When they send orders, I execute them. <--- Is this part called Flow Trader? We have execution traders who execute the trades but does it mean something different?

I buy and sell stocks, options, futures. Also, when they want to have some strategies, they send me a target number and I check the markets and when it works, I do it. Before and end of the market I go out to meet my clients and briefly discuss the market events and do sales job. I organize research points and conference calls if they want it. I guess this is what normal stock brokers do.

Also, there is a special arbitrage fund that I trade for the clients on my decision. I trade stock-futures arbitrage or index-futures arbitrage, and the profit goes to the clients and I make fees as my profit. No overnight position is allowed so it is a day trading.

Am I a Equity Derivative Trader? or is that referring something different? Am I a Passive Sales Broker or something else? Am I a Flow Trader? My execution trade requires little more thinking than just simple execution clicks.

What other positions in a finance industry would be relevant if I were to change my job?
